2013-05-22 3 views
2

У меня возникли проблемы с ссылкой на изображение продукта на моем сайте NopCommerce.nop commerce ссылки изображения

Я изменил галерею слайдов по умолчанию в галерею стиля буклета. я сумел сослаться на 1-ое изображение продукта, вставив код:

в правильное мнение. Теперь мне нужно ссылаться на изображение второго продукта на второй странице моей брошюры.

до сих пор у меня есть:

добавил определение в каталоге контроллера:

model.PictureModel.Page2Url = _pictureService.GetPictureUrl(productVariant.PictureId, _mediaSettings.ProductVariantPictureSize, false); 

Я также добавил это к модели изображения:

public string Page2Url { get; set; } 

после этого я вставил этот код:

Page2Url = _pictureService.GetPictureUrl(pictures.FirstOrDefault(),  _mediaSettings.ProductDetailsPictureSize), 

в контроллер каталога, где указано 1-е изображение. это теперь, поскольку код говорит, что он должен, ссылаясь на 1-ое изображение продукта снова. что мне нужно изменить, чтобы заставить его назвать изображение второго продукта?

Мой сайт:

Egiftingwizard.com

+0

Я думаю, что не хватает информации или ваш вопрос не очень понятно? –

ответ

3

Вы можете попробовать пропустить, взять в Linq To взять 2 изображение продукта. Попробуйте

Page2Url = _pictureService.GetPictureUrl (pictures.Skip (1) .Снять (1), _mediaSettings.ProductDetailsPictureSize)

Смежные вопросы